Lumion Pro 12.0 is a 3D rendering software designed specifically for architects, urban planners, and landscape designers. Unlike complex, slow render engines (like V-Ray or Corona), Lumion operates on a "real-time" feedback loop. Previous versions struggled with realistic light beams (god rays). Lumion Pro 12.0 introduced precise volumetric spotlights. You can now render a museum with thin dust particles floating in a beam of sunlight or a nightclub with colored laser beams interacting with fog.
